Track & Field to Compete in Philly Mets, Princeton Invite this Weekend

4.23.21 | Women's Track and Field

PHILADELPHIA – The Temple track and field team will compete in the Philadelphia Metropolitan meet on Saturday, Apr. 24 at Franklin Field before competing in the Princeton Invite on Sunday, Apr. 25. 
 
About the Philly Mets
> The Philly Mets is hosted by the Penn Relays. The traditional Penn Relays were canceled this year due to the ongoing pandemic.
> The collegiate-only track meet will combine traditional Penn Relay events and individual events for qualification purposes.
> Joining Temple in the Division I field is Delaware, La Salle, Penn, Rider, St. Joseph's and Villanova.
> The meet will begin at 2 p.m.

About the Princeton Invite
> Sunday's meet will be Princeton's first competition of the season as Princeton Athletics was awaiting approval to move into Ivy Phase Four, which allows for local competition.
> The meet will begin at 11 a.m at Weaver Stadium. 

Last Time Out
> On Saturday Apr. 18, the Owls competed in the Quaker Invite at Franklin Field. 
> The 4x100m relay squad of Chelby Elam, Chidumga Nkulume, Jewel Ofotan and Marissa White started the meet on a high note with their first-place time of 47.98. 
> Ragan-Lei Phillips followed with a first-place finish of her own in the 100m hurdles, crossing the finish line at a personal-best 15.14.
> In the 400m, Alanna Lally led the Owls with her first-place mark of 56.40, followed closely by White in second at 56.48.
> Elam was the first in the Cherry and White to cross the finish line in the 100m, clocking in at 12.22 for second place. Nkulume followed in third with her mark of 12.48. 
> In the 200m, White recorded a second-place finish at 24.91, followed by Elam's personal-best 25.01 for third. 
> In the heptathlon, Sophia Gulotti recorded a second-place finish in the event with 4260 points. The Wilmington, Del. native finished second and recorded personal bests in all but two events.
> Nicole Castor finished in third place with 4216 points. The rookie earned a first-place finish in the high jump with her mark of 9.09m.
